Create the future of e-health together with us by becoming a Client Sales Executive

At Compu Group Medical we have the mission of building ground-breaking solutions for digital healthcare. Our vision is revolutionizing how healthcare professionals produce, access, and utilize information and thus enabling them to focus on the core value of their work: patient outcomes.

Your Contribution:
  • Foster and strengthen relationships between CGM US and its client base by delivering tailored selling solutions that enhance client workflows and drive long-term value.
  • Effectively managing the full sales cycle from initial prospecting through successful close using pipeline management to generate and present accurate quotes to clients.
  • Leverage established client partnerships to drive additional sales growth through renewal, expansion, and add-on solutions.
  • Execute company marketing campaigns for product growth to existing clients.
  • Coordinate escalated project or support issues to ensure timely resolution and customer satisfaction.
Your

Qualification:
  • Associate's degree from an accredited university required; bachelor's degree from an accredited university preferred.
  • Minimum 3 years of industry experience in vendor or healthcare setting.
  • Previous Selling Solutions /or Customer Relationship Management experience preferred.
  • Previous software vendor experience in healthcare information technology setting preferred.
  • Some familiarity with Clinical Laboratory and/or billing software services.
  • Proven ability to build trust and conduct impactful conversations with C-level executives through strong commun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Understanding of hospital and patient care workflows.
  • This position requires up to 60% travel to client sites, including the potential for overnight stays as needed.
